BACKGROUND <br /> After completion of soil sampling activities from the fuel <br /> tank pit and product pipe trenches in December, 1989, a <br /> water sample was taken from the on-site domestic well <br /> system. The water sample was taken while the pump was <br /> operating to avoid drawing water from the holding tank and <br /> after the well was purged. <br /> The water sample was analyzed for total petroleum hydrocar- <br /> bons (TPH) as gasoline using EPA methods 5030 and 8015, <br /> benzene, toluene, xylenes and ethylbenzene (BTX&E) using EPA <br /> 503 . 1, halogenated volatile organics using EPA 502. 1, <br /> tetraethyl lead using DHS-LUFT and ethylene dibromide using <br /> EPA 504 . <br /> Analyses of the water sample from the on-site domestic well <br /> indicate 160 ppb TPH as gasoline with non-detectable <br /> concentrations of all other analytes. <br /> Mr. Harlin Knoll of the San Joaquin County Public Health <br /> Services (SJCPHS) , per telephone conversations on February 7 <br /> and March 8, 1990, has required that this water well be <br /> properly destroyed due to the levels of TPH as gasoline <br /> indicated in the laboratory analyses results and that one <br /> additional water sample be collected after all piping and <br /> the pump are removed from the well, and the well purged of <br /> at least three to four well volumes. <br /> A recent site inspection conducted on March 15, 1990 by Mr. <br /> Don Braun of Kaprealian Engineering, Inc.
